Right now, the search (and other text matching) doesn’t handle differences between small and big hiragana/katakana or between full-width and half-width characters. For example, if I import data from a CSV file, it might contain “ラクテン” (half-width katakana), but when I search for “らくてん” (hiragana), it doesn’t show up. This makes it hard to find results when there are variations in how the text is written.
It’s similar to how English search works with uppercase and lowercase letters. When you search for “Apple,” you expect it to match “apple” too. Adding this feature would make search much more intuitive, especially since differences in Japanese text formatting are so common.
